Advertisement

JSON转JSON Schema

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
将JSON数据转换为遵循JSON Schema规范的过程描述,帮助用户验证和描述JSON文档结构。 将JSON转换为JSON Schema的过程涉及定义一个描述数据结构的模式文件。这个过程需要分析原始JSON文档中的键值对,并创建相应的类型、属性和其他约束条件来确保未来的数据实例符合既定的标准。通过这种方式,可以提高代码可维护性和数据的一致性。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• JSONJSON Schema
    优质
    将JSON数据转换为遵循JSON Schema规范的过程描述,帮助用户验证和描述JSON文档结构。 将JSON转换为JSON Schema的过程涉及定义一个描述数据结构的模式文件。这个过程需要分析原始JSON文档中的键值对,并创建相应的类型、属性和其他约束条件来确保未来的数据实例符合既定的标准。通过这种方式,可以提高代码可维护性和数据的一致性。
  • JSON Schema离线生成工具
    优质
    JSON Schema离线生成工具是一款功能强大的本地化应用软件,它能够在无需网络连接的情况下自动生成和验证JSON数据模式。此工具极大地方便了开发者进行快速、高效的JSON模式设计与调试工作。 通过JSON报文自动生成schema。
  • JSONExcel JSONExcel
    优质
    简介:该工具或服务提供将JSON格式的数据转换为Excel表格的功能,便于用户处理和分析复杂数据结构。 欢迎转载Java实现JSON文件到Excel文件转换的工具类。
  • React-Json-Editor: 响应式的动态表单组件,支持JSON-Schema
    优质
    React-Json-Editor是一款响应式且功能强大的动态表单组件,专为React应用设计。它兼容JSON-Schema,简化了复杂数据模型的编辑和展示过程。 react-json-editor 是一个基于规范格式的动态表单组件,用于创建丛状结构以保持数据的一致性。 该项目展示了如何使用完整的代码来实现 react-json-editor 功能。 它通过一个 JavaScript 对象描述用户需要提供的数据模式,并根据该模式自动生成表单。此外,它还利用相同的模式对用户的输入进行验证。 欢迎捐款和支持。 我很乐意接受 PR(Pull Request)。如果您想帮忙但不知道从何做起,请查看待办事项列表。 最小示例: ```javascript var React = require(react); var Form = require(react-json-editor).default; ``` 这里使用了`require`来引入React和 react-json-editor 组件。
  • JSON Schema验证规范的中文版本
    优质
    本项目提供JSON Schema验证规范的官方中文翻译版,帮助开发者更好地理解和应用JSON数据结构验证标准。 JSON Schema(application / schema + json)的一个重要用途是用于验证JSON实例。本段落档为JSON Schema定义了一个词汇表,该词汇表描述了JSON文档的含义,并且可以为使用JSON数据的用户界面提供提示,同时也能对有效文档进行schema验证。
  • JSON工具类(Json换)
    优质
    本项目提供一系列用于处理和解析JSON数据的实用工具类,旨在简化复杂的Json对象转换与操作过程,提高开发效率。 JsonUtils(Json转换工具类)是一个用于处理JSON数据的实用工具类。它可以方便地将Java对象与JSON字符串进行相互转换,简化了开发人员在项目中的数据交换工作。使用此类可以大大提高代码的可读性和维护性,并且减少了手动编写解析和生成JSON格式文本时可能出现的错误。
  • Vue-Form-Json-Schema:利用JSON模式构建表单,轻松集成组件!
    优质
    Vue-Form-Json-Schema是一款基于JSON Schema的Vue.js插件,它能够帮助开发者快速、高效地创建和管理复杂的表单。通过使用该插件,可以方便地将JSON Schema转换成可交互的表单界面,并轻松集成各种自定义组件,从而提高开发效率并保证代码的一致性和规范性。 Vue表单JSON模式是一个基于的表单生成器,可以使用任何Vue组件或HTML元素。无需受限于预构建的组件让您感到困惑;相反,您可以利用发出事件(自定义或本机)的任意组件或元素进行操作。值得注意的是,大多数采用v-model指令的Vue组件都会触发input或其他类似事件。 从v1版本升级?请查看相关文档以确定此次迁移是否以及如何影响您。 安装方法:使用npm命令行工具 ``` npm install vue-form-json-schema ``` 导入到您的应用中: ```javascript import Vue from vue; import VueFormJsonSchema from vue-form-json-schema; ```
  • JSON-ListJSON对象详解
    优质
    本文详细解析了如何将JSON-List格式转换为JSON对象的过程和方法,帮助开发者更高效地处理数据结构。 这篇文章主要介绍了如何将List集合转换为JSON对象,并认为这一方法非常实用。现在分享给大家作为参考。
  • ExcelJSON
    优质
    本工具提供将Excel表格数据转换为JSON格式的功能,方便用户轻松处理和传输数据。支持多工作表与多种数据类型。 将Excel表格转换成Json文件,请参考源代码:https://github.com/neil3d/excel2json。不过根据要求要去除链接,则简化表述如下: 使用EXE工具可以实现从Excel到JSON的转换,相关源代码可在GitHub上找到。 按照你的需求去掉所有链接后,信息如下: 将Excel表格转换成Json文件,请参考该EXE程序及其配套的源代码。
  • JSON2Map:多层JSONMap及再单层JSON
    优质
    JSON2Map是一款便捷工具,能够将复杂的多层JSON结构转换为易于操作的扁平化Map,并支持从Map反向生成单层JSON格式,极大提升了数据处理效率。 在实习期间遇到需要将多层嵌套的JSON转换为单层JSON的需求,并且还需要对JSON进行格式化处理。参考网上的方法后,使用谷歌Gson库通过递归实现了这一功能。例如,原始数据如下: ```json { code:200, message:ok, data:{\id\:131,\appId\:6,\versionCode\:6014000} } ``` 转换后的结果为: ```json { code: 200, data.appId: 6, data.versionCode: 6014000, data.id: 131, message: ok } ``` 使用Gson中的JsonParser来实现这个功能。